You would expect a cell with an extensive Golgi apparatus to?

Secrete a lot of material:The Golgi apparatus performs several functions in close partnership with the ER. Serving as a molecular warehouse and finishing factory, a Golgi apparatus receives and modifies substances manufactured by the ER. One side of a Golgi stack serves as a receiving dock for transport vesicles produced by the ER. When a Golgi receives transport vesicles containing glycoprotein molecules, for instance, it takes in the materials and then modifies them chemically. One function of this chemical modification seems to be to mark and sort the molecules into different batches for different destinations. Molecules may be moved from sac to sac in the Golgi by transport vesicles, or, according to recent research, entire sacs may move from the receiving to the shipping side, modifying their protein cargo as they go. The shipping side of the Golgi stack serves as a depot from which finished secretory products, packaged in transport vesicles, move to the plasma membrane for export from the cell. Alternatively, finished products may become part of the plasma membrane itself or part of another organelle, such as a lysosome, which we discuss next.


What is a raised area on the Cerebral Cortex?

A Ridge/Hill is called a Gyrus (pl Gyri) and a cleft/valley is called a Sulcus (pl Sulci). Some of the Gyri and Sulci are individually named for example look at the cerebrum from a lateral view. You should see one fairly distinct vertical sulcus roughly in the middle of the brain (it will not be straight but reasonably obviously vertical. This is called the Central Sulcus. The gyrus immediately in front of that sulcus is called the Precentral Gyrus and the one behind is called the Postcentral Gyrus. The precentral is where the Primary Motor Cortex is seen and the postcentral is where the Somatosensory Cortex is seen. There are many other named sulci and gyri but it is too complicated to describe them without an image.

What does the Golgi vessicles do in the endoplasmic reticulum?

Among several things the Golgi does is to further process proteins shipped from the endoplasmic reticulum, prepare these proteins for shipment to parts of the cell and outside the cell by enclosing them in vesicles and tagging them as to point of shipment. The Golgi also manufactures the lysosomes. The Golgi apparatus is not in the ER, but is its own organelle of the endomembrane system and is not a vesicle, but ships products enclosed in vesicles.
